A four-year-old Chilean boy was injured after suffering an alleged electric shock inside a supermarket in La Serena.The minor was taken to the Coquimbo Hospital, where he was admitted for medical care.At the instruction of the Macrozona prosecutor, staff of the La Serena Homicide Brigade went to the commercial compound, located at the intersection of Gabriela Mistral with Cuatro Esquinas, to carry out the first investigations.
A four-year-old is in a life-threatening state after being electrocuted at a supermarket in La Serena, Coquimbo region. The minor remains hospitalized with mechanical ventilation after receiving an electrical discharge that left him unconscious for about two minutes.
